Abstract

This research aims to analyze the effect of mergers on the financial performance of a manufacturing company using profitability ratios proxied with return on assets (ROA) and return on equity (ROE), liquidity ratios proxied with current ratio (CR) and quick ratio (QR), as well as the activity ratio projected by total asset turnover (TATO). Where a merger is a business combination of two or more companies into one company then only one company remains alive as a legal entity, while the other stops its activity or dissolves. The population in this research is obtained by using purposive sampling method at manufacturing company which listed in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) which conducting merger activity in 2012, and based on predetermined criterion, 2 sample of manufacturing company that merged in 2012. The analytical method used to measure financial performance by using financial ratio analysis, parametric test covering paired sample t-test with spss 21 application tool.the results of the paired sample t-test showed that there was a significant difference in the ratio of return on assets (ROA), quick ratio (QR) and total asset turnover (TATO) in the four years before and four years after the merger. While the ratio of return on equity (ROE) and current ratio (CR) showed no significant differences during the year of research.
